    Default Monday Morning Fishing Trivia # 50


    In 1963 a lure company in Ill came out with a musky lure that became real popular. Actually it was made in two sizes , a 2 3/4 in. for bass and a 4 3/4 in. for musky. It was a top water lure with a propeller on the front and three treble hooks, one on each side and one on the back. Can you name this lure or the company ?
